Biography

Dr Siobhán Lucey is a Consultant and Senior Lecturer in Paediatric Dentistry in the Cork University Dental School and Hospital. Following graduation from UCC, Dr Lucey completed specialist training in Paediatric Dentistry in the Edinburgh Dental Institute and graduated from the University of Edinburgh with a Masters in Clinical Dentistry. She obtained her Membership in Paediatric Dentistry from the Royal College of Surgeons of Edinburgh in 2013. She was awarded a Fellowship in Dental Surgery by the Royal College of Surgeons of Ireland in 2022. Dr Lucey has successfully completed the Diploma in Teaching and Learning in Higher Education with UCC. She is enrolled as a PhD candidate with UCC, and her doctoral work will explore the impact of learning spaces in dental education. She was President of the Irish Society of Paediatric Dentistry for 2020/21 and former Deputy Chair (Academic Staff) for the Mná@UCC Women's Network. Dr Lucey is passionate about the oral health of children and is committed to excellence in teaching and learning in oral health education.
